Welcome to 19 Emscote Green, Solihull, a cozy and compact terraced type home with 3 bed in the B91 1TB area. This lovely residence, which comes with the freedom and stability of a freehold ownership, and sits comfortably in tax band D.
This classic property was built 1950-1966 and has a reported internal area of 84 internal square metres

"A modern style three bedroom end town house in a cul-de-sac located near to many local amenties, schools and the transport network, The property benefits from central heating and double glazing.
Enclosed Porch, Entrance Hall, Fitted Kitchen Diner, Lounge, Conservatory, Downstairs W.C, Three Bedrooms, Bathroom, Foregarden with Parking, Double Side Garage, Small, Delightful Rear Garden.
An opportunity to acquire a modern style end town house set in a cul-de-sac location, being near to many amenities, schools and the transport network. The property benefiting from central heating and double gazing, offering accommodation comprising;- enclosed porch, entrance hall, fitted kitchen diner, lounge, conservatory, downstairs w.c., three bedrooms, bathroom, foregarden with parking, double side garage and small delightful rear garden.
Porch
With double glazed entrance door, lighting, tiled flooring and door to:-
Entrance Hall
Having staircase to the first floor, central heating radiator, under stairs storage, tiled flooring and doors off to:-
Lounge 17?9? x 11?7? max
With tiled flooring, fitted gas fire, central heating radiator, coving to ceiling, ceiling and wall light points and double glazed sliding doors to the conservatory.
Kitchen / Diner 12?2? x 8?10?
Being fitted with an extensive range of base units with drawers and cupboards, matching wall cupboards, corner displays, some with glazed leaded doors. Ceramic tiled splashbacks, integrated gas hob, double electric oven, dishwasher, freezer and fridge. Further breakfast bar, ceramic tiled splashbacks and floor, central heating radiator, extractor, under cabinet light and double glazed leaded bow window to the front with blinds.
Downstairs W.C.
With ceramic tiled floor and walls, low flush w.c., wash hand basin and central heating radiator.
Conservatory 12?0? x 10?8?
Having ceramic tiled floor, two central heating radiators, roof lights, fitted blinds, double glazed double opening doors to the rear garden.
ON THE FIRST FLOOR
Landing
Having access to loft and doors off to:-
Bedroom One (rear) 11?3? x 9?7?
Having fitted wardrobes, central heating radiator, coving to ceiling and double glazed window.
Bedroom Two (front) 10?6? x 9?5?
Having fitted wardrobes, central heating radiator and double glazed window.
Bedroom Three (front) 8?4? x 8?0?
Having central heating radiator, storage area and double glazed window.
Bathroom
Having marble tiled flooring and ceramic tiled walls, suite comprising wash hand basin, low flush w.c. and shower cubicle with shower unit, central heating radiator, extractor, two stage cupboards, wall mirror and double glazed frosted window with blinds.
OUTSIDE
Foregarden
Having paved path way and lawn.
Double Garage 15?5? x 16?9?
Having motorised door, working surface cupboards, plumbing, power and light. Pedestrian door to rear garden.
Rear Garden
With lawn, timber fence and cane fenced boundaries, timber pergola, conifer screen, lawn with borders. Water feature, garden lighting and paved pathway to the side.
